Flat Laurel Creek Hike
- This loop takes you around the headwaters basin of Flat Laurel Creek, which starts in a unique, high-elevation valley surrounded by sharp peaks, grassy balds, and cool, dark, spruce-fir forests. Its elevation is over 5300 ft at the bottom, and it...
- 2.5mi, Climbs Gently
- Tread Condition: Moderately Rough
Sam Knob Hike
- At the top of an imposing mountain peak located at the edge of the Shining Rock Wilderness, spectacular views await! A surprisingly nice, easy trail wraps around this mountain to its grassy, partly bald summit. Hike in the late summer and enjoy a...
- 2.2mi, Climbs Moderately
- Tread Condition: Moderately Rough
